Quick and Easy Coconut Curry Shrimp

This dish features succulent shrimp cooked in a fragrant coconut milk-based curry sauce, infused with spices and herbs. The recipe serves 4 and takes about 25 minutes to prepare and cook.

Ingredients

  • 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 1 medium onion, finely ch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 1 tablespoon red curry paste
  • 1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
  • 1 tablespoon fish sauce
  • 1 tablespoon brown sugar
  • 1 b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 cup snap peas or green beans
  • Fresh cilantro for garnish
  • Lime wedges for serving
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Heat Oil: In a large sk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
  2. Add Aromatics: Stir in the minced garlic and grated ginger, cooking for another minute until fragrant.
  3. Incorporate Curry Paste: Add the red curry paste and cook for 1-2 minutes, stirring to combine with the aromatics.
  4. Add Coconut Milk: Pour in the coconut milk, fish sauce, and brown sugar. Stir well and bring to a simmer.
  5. Cook the Shrimp: Add the shrimp, bell pepper, and snap peas. Cook for 5-7 minutes, or until the shrimp are pink and cooked through.
  6. Season: Taste and adjust seasoning with salt and pepper as needed.
  7. Serve: Garnish with fresh cilantro and serve with lime wedges over rice or with naan.

Cook and Prep Times

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es

Nutrition Information

  • Servings: 4 servings
  • Calories: 320kcal
  • Fat: 18g
  • Protein: 24g
  • Carbohydrates: 12g
